Mermaids (2025)
Summer holidays in Greece. A flirt under the scorched sun pushes two opposite friend groups on a journey of sexual discovery, lust, consent, and complete transformation.
Directing:
Writing:
Stars:
- Dimitris Tsakaleas
- Lida Vartzioti
Writing:
- Dimitris Tsakaleas
- Lida Vartzioti
Stars:
Release Date: 2025-09-11
- Country: GR
- Language: ελληνικά
- Runtime: 15